SHILLONG: The Meghalaya Youth Foundation (MYF) in collaboration with the Indian Council of Agricultural Research (ICAR), Umiam will be distributing agricultural equipments to the farmers of Mawpyrshong village, East Khasi Hills district on Thursday from 10:30 am onwards.

Renowned personalities of the State, Scientists of ICAR and other personalities will be present at the programme.

Mawpyrshong village has been adopted by the Inner Wheel Club, Shillong and the Meghalaya Youth Foundation. ICAR in the past had also extended assistance to the farmers of the village by donating piglets, poultry, pig sheds, water tanks, agricultural seeds, manures, fertilisers, besides conduct numerous training and capacity building programmes for farmers in the field of agriculture and animal husbandry.
